A news feature by Danielle Hyams, published 12 January 2020 by The Haitian Times, a Haitian-American news outlet, marking the tenth anniversary of the 2010 Haiti earthquake. Reliable for American televangelist Pat Robertson publicly attributing the earthquake, which killed more than 200,000 people, to a supposed Vodou "pact with the devil" in Haiti's founding; for Vodouisants in Haiti facing attacks and being denied emergency medical assistance in the disaster's aftermath; and for a further wave of blame and violence when a cholera epidemic struck Haiti later that year, in which the article states dozens of Vodou priests were lynched. The article gives no month, location or victim count more precise than "dozens" for the lynchings, and this atlas carries that hedge rather than sharpening it.
